Block #2627963

Hashf414ffcabf3837eb90d696bbc9f31e68c0d43bb93a449779800d62eef1529493
Timestamp15th May 2024 00:59:03 extracted by Proof of Stake
Transactions20.4 kB
Value Out10.00000000 MERGE
Difficulty130746.803860090
Confirmations61138
Bits1b008051
Nonce0
 Get Raw Block Data